Desiccant Dehumidification Cost In Kenmore, WA

The cost of Desiccant Dehumidification in Kenmore, WA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. We provide free estimates for every job, so you can get a clear understanding of the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area
Containment and Equipment Setup $500 – $2,000 The type and quantity of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ture involved
Monitoring and Cleanup $500 – $2,000 The complexity of the job and the amount of equipment needed

The exact cost of Desiccant Dehumidification in Kenmore, WA will depend on the specifics of your job. We provide free estimates for every project, so you can get a clear understanding of the costs involved.
